As you enter into Grades 7 and 8 at South Orangetown Middle School for the 2021-22 school year, you will have numerous opportunities to participate in activities for the school; one of those opportunities is interscholastic modified athletics. Our District offers many of these sports for our seventh- and eighth-graders and they are a great way for you to become more involved at SOMS.

Here is the process of registering for interscholastic sports at SOMS.

  • Online registration will open 30 days (in accordance with NYS law) prior to the start of the season. Fall modified sports registration will open August 9, 2021 via this link: https://socsd.powermediallc.org/
  • Upon your initial visit to the website, you must create a profile and enter medical information.
  • After the profile is created, visits to the site will have you sign in and fill out a “packet” for each season. One family profile can have up to 4 children. Student athletes must have a valid physical within the last year to be approved to participate. Parents can upload a physical to their profile. If needed, the district can provide a physical if necessary through the school medical director. However, we encourage parents to obtain a physical from their child’s health care provider.

Practices and contests are held Monday through Friday during the season. The following are the start dates for each season:

Fall: September 9, 2021
Modified sports offerings: Football, Boys Soccer, Girls Soccer, Girls Tennis, Boys Cross Country, Girls Cross Country, Girls Swimming and Volleyball

Winter: November 29, 2021
Modified sports offerings: Bowling, Boys Basketball, Boys Swimming, Fencing, Girls Basketball, Ice Hockey and Wrestling

Spring: March 28, 2022
Modified sports offerings: Baseball, Boys Golf, Boys Lacrosse, Boys Tennis, Girls Golf, Girls Lacrosse, Softball and Track & Field
